About the Author
Ambassador Carmen G. Cantor (Ret.) most recently served as the Assistant Secretary for Insular and International Affairs at the U.S. Department of the Interior. Her distinguished three-decade public service career included her role as U.S.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ary to the Federated States of Micronesia and senior leadership positions at the U.S. Department of State. She is recognized for her inclusive leadership, cross-cultural bridge-building, and commitment to advancing the voices of island communities.
